Chocolate Peanut Clusters

A quick and delightful snack combining rich chocolate with salted peanuts for a satisfying treat.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 5 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ings: 12 pieces
Course: Dessert, Snack
Cuisine: American
Calories: 220

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ients
  • 400 g milk or dark chocolate Use high-quality chocolate for richer flavor.
  • 275 g salted peanuts You can experiment with different nuts for unique clusters.

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Melt the chocolate in a large bowl or jug using a microwave or a stovetop method.
  2. Once melted, stir in the salted peanuts until well coated.
  3. Line two trays with parchment paper.
  4. Dollop spoonfuls of the mixture onto the parchment and press slightly to form clusters.
  5. Refrigerate for about 30 minutes until fully hardened.
Serving
  1. Serve clusters on their own, or with vanilla ice cream, fruit salad, or coffee.
Storage
  1. Store in an airtight container in the refrigerator to prevent melting.
  2. For longer storage, freeze in a single layer on a baking sheet.

Notes

Add a sprinkle of sea salt on top before refrigeration for an extra flavor kick. Don’t rush the melting process; stir frequently to avoid burning.
